When water unexpectedly invades your Cherokee property, the clock starts ticking much faster than most homeowners realize. Structural damage, including compromised subfloors, framing, and drywall, begins to compound significantly after just 72 hours if moisture remains. Simply letting a wet area air dry is rarely sufficient; without professional structural drying, hidden moisture can lead to long-term issues like wood rot, weakened building materials, and persistent odors. Understanding this critical timeline is essential for protecting your investment and preventing more extensive, costly repairs down the line. Water Damage Restoration in Cherokee, NC

Cherokee properties, particularly those older homes with crawl spaces or basements near the Oconaluftee River, face unique water damage challenges. Heavy rains, common during our spring and summer storm seasons, can quickly overwhelm drainage systems or lead to groundwater intrusion, especially in areas with natural elevation changes. We often see damage from burst pipes in older plumbing systems during winter freezes, or from appliance failures in homes built decades ago. Our water damage restoration process begins with a thorough inspection to identify the source and extent of the damage, using advanced moisture detection equipment to locate hidden saturation. We then extract standing water, followed by commercial-grade drying and dehumidification to remove moisture from structural materials and contents. This rapid response is critical to prevent secondary damage and mold growth, ensuring your Cherokee home or business is returned to its pre-damage condition efficiently.

Mold Remediation in Cherokee

The humid climate of Western North Carolina, especially during the long summer months, creates an ideal environment for mold growth in Cherokee properties. Coupled with the prevalence of older homes that may have less-than-perfect ventilation or crawl spaces, mold can quickly become a significant issue after any water event or even prolonged high indoor humidity. We frequently encounter mold in basements, attics, and wall cavities where moisture has been present for an extended period, often exacerbated by the region's frequent rainfall. Our mold remediation process involves containment to prevent cross-contamination, followed by air filtration to capture airborne spores. We then safely remove mold-infested materials, thoroughly clean and treat affected surfaces, and apply antimicrobial agents. Finally, we address the underlying moisture source to prevent future mold growth, ensuring a healthy indoor environment for your Cherokee home or business.

What should I do immediately after a pipe bursts in my Cherokee home?

After a pipe bursts, immediately shut off the main water supply to your home to stop the flow. Then, contact SERVPRO of Haywood & Transylvania Counties right away for professional water extraction and drying services to prevent further damage and mold growth.

How quickly can mold start growing in my Cherokee property after water damage?

Mold can begin to colonize within 24 to 48 hours after water exposure, especially in the humid climate of Cherokee. Prompt water removal and professional drying are crucial to prevent widespread mold issues.
